Several key factors are propelling the growth of the railway passenger service system market. Firstly, the global push for sustainable transportation is significantly boosting investment in railway infrastructure and modernization. Governments worldwide are prioritizing railways as a cleaner and more efficient alternative to road transport, leading to large-scale projects involving the implementation of advanced passenger service systems. Secondly, the rising demand for enhanced passenger experience is a significant driver. Passengers increasingly expect seamless, convenient, and information-rich travel experiences. This demand is driving the adoption of mobile ticketing, real-time information displays, and integrated passenger information systems that provide comprehensive travel updates and assistance. Furthermore, technological advancements, such as the development of sophisticated data analytics and AI-powered solutions, are improving operational efficiency, predictive maintenance, and resource allocation. This optimization reduces costs and enhances service reliability, making railway systems more attractive to both passengers and operators. Finally, increasing urbanization and the need for efficient mass transit solutions in densely populated areas are contributing to the market's expansion.
Despite the positive growth outlook, the railway passenger service system market faces several challenges. High initial investment costs for implementing new systems and upgrading existing infrastructure can be a significant barrier for some railway operators, particularly in developing countries. The integration of different systems from various vendors can also present complexities, requiring significant effort and expertise in system compatibility and data management. Cybersecurity concerns are also paramount, as the increasing reliance on digital systems makes railway networks vulnerable to cyberattacks that could disrupt services and compromise passenger data. Furthermore, maintaining the security and reliability of these systems in the face of potential technological failures is a continual concern. The need for skilled professionals to operate and maintain these complex systems is another significant hurdle that the industry is facing in the coming years, especially in a context of global talent shortages. Finally, the regulatory landscape varies significantly across different regions, making it challenging for companies to standardize their offerings and operate globally without encountering regulatory hurdles.
